What does fault code po504 Volvo s60?

Fault code P0504 for a Volvo S60 indicates a problem with the brake light switch circuit, specifically that the brake light switch signal is inconsistent or malfunctioning. This can lead to issues with the brake lights not functioning properly, which may affect vehicle safety and performance. It's advisable to inspect the brake light switch and its wiring for any faults or disconnections to resolve the issue.


On do you change brake pads on a Volvo S60?

To change the brake pads on a Volvo S60, first, lift the car and remove the wheel to access the brake caliper. Next, unbolt the caliper and slide it off the rotor, then remove the old brake pads from the caliper bracket. Install the new pads, reattach the caliper, and finally, replace the wheel. Be sure to pump the brake pedal to seat the new pads before driving.

How do you fix brake lights on Volvo s60?

To fix brake lights on a Volvo S60, first check the brake light bulbs for any signs of burnout and replace them if necessary. Next, inspect the brake light switch, located near the brake pedal, for proper operation; replacing it may resolve the issue if it's faulty. Additionally, check the fuse related to the brake lights in the fuse box, as a blown fuse can also cause the lights to malfunction. If these steps don't solve the problem, consider consulting a professional mechanic for further diagnosis.
